πŸ₯˜ Ingredients

13 items
  • 1 lb flank steak
  • 3 tbsp soy sauce
  • 2 tsp cornstarch
  • 2 tbsp vegetable oil
  • 1 red bell pepper
  • 1 green bell pepper
  • 1 onion
  • 2 garlic cloves
  • 1 tsp ground black pepper
  • 1 cup beef broth
  • 2 tbsp oyster sauce
  • 1 tsp brown sugar
  • 2 cups rice (optional, for serving)

πŸ“ Instructions

9 steps
1

Slice the flank steak thinly against the grain into bite-sized strips.

2

In a medium bowl, mix 2 tablespoons of soy sauce and cornstarch. Add the steak and toss to coat evenly. Let the beef marinate for 10 minutes.

3

While the beef marinates, slice the red bell pepper, green bell pepper, and onion into thin strips. Mince the garlic cloves.

4

In a small bowl, prepare the sauce by combining the beef broth, remaining 1 tablespoon of soy sauce, oyster sauce, ground black pepper, and brown sugar. Stir to mix and set aside.

5

Heat 1 tablespoon of vegetable oil in a large skillet or wok over medium-high heat. Once hot, add the marinated beef and sear for 2–3 minutes, until browned. Remove the beef and set aside.

6

Add the remaining 1 tablespoon of vegetable oil to the skillet. Add the bell peppers, onion, and garlic. Stir-fry for 3–4 minutes, until the vegetables are tender-crisp.

7

Return the cooked beef to the skillet. Pour the prepared sauce over the beef and vegetables, stirring well to combine.

8

Cook for an additional 2–3 minutes, allowing the sauce to thicken slightly.

9

Serve the pepper steak hot over steamed rice, if desired.
